Re: How to lose 6 pounds in 8 hours

This is the first year we didn't have a weight loss problem because we painstakingly did everything in CAD, made sure all the material properties were set, and also designed 10 pounds under.

In 2005 we were about 10 pounds over, we spent the last week filling every square inch of the bot with holes except for the chassis. Our anodized chassis plate was covered in sharpie marks after all the cutting so we doused it in isopropyl alcohol and set it on fire Not as quick as scrubbing it with solvent, but much more fun.

Re: How to lose 6 pounds in 8 hours

This year we weighed in at 119.9 of 120.

Last year (rookie year) we made our electrical panel out of two sheets of 3/8 plexiglass, which was eventually swiss-cheesed beyond recognition. This year we made it out of 1/16 fiber composite (grade GR-10/FR-4 Garolite).

P.S. Garolite is amazing stuff.
